• 关于我们
  • 产品
  • 钱包教程
  • 支持
Sign in Get Started
        
            

        2023年最新区块链钱包开发语言选择指南2026-06-01 14:49:49

        区块链钱包是什么,为什么它重要?

        区块链钱包,简单来说,就是你存放数字货币的地方。就像是你的银行账户,但这个账户是去中心化的,意味著你不需要依赖任何机构来管理你的资产。近几年,随着比特币、以太坊等数字货币的火热,区块链钱包的重要性越来越凸显了。

        想象一下,手里有个钱包,但这个钱包不是实体的,而是存储在网络上的。你的一切资产和交易记录都在这里,没有人能够轻易篡改。这种安全感让越来越多人开始关注区块链钱包,打算自己开发一个,或者至少理解这个领域。

        开发区块链钱包需要什么技能?

        首先,你需要有一定的编程基础。不同类型的区块链钱包(热钱包、冷钱包等)可能需要不同的技能和工具。最常用的几种编程语言就是你需要了解的知识,比如JavaScript、Python、Java等。

        哦,别担心,如果你在某种语言上不是太熟悉,依然可以学习。一开始可以从JavaScript入手,因为它简单易学,而且在开发Web钱包时非常常用。你可以找到很多在线教程、视频和社区来帮助你入门,甚至可以在周末尝试做一个简单的 demo 哦。

        JavaScript开发钱包的优势

        JavaScript 是前端开发的首选语言,对于Web钱包来说,几乎是无可替代的选择。很多开发者都在用它来制作钱包,因为它支持多种框架,比如React、Vue等,这让用户界面的设计变得更加高效和便捷。

        而且,JavaScript 的生态圈很庞大。比如说,Node.js 的出现,让它可以在服务器端运用。这样的话,你就可以用同一种语言来同时开发前端和后端,大大减少学习成本。

        Python:开源项目的好伴侣

        如果你偏向于后台开发,可以试试 Python。由于其简洁易读的特性,Python 很受开发者欢迎。它有丰富的库支持,比如 Web3.py,可以用来和以太坊进行交互。

        而且,Python 还常被用在数据分析和机器学习中,如果你对这些领域感兴趣的话,学好 Python 绝对是个不错的选择。这样一来,你的区块链钱包不仅能支持交易,还能通过数据分析找到潜在的投资机会。

        Java:稳重可靠的企业级选择

        说到 Java,大家可能会到大型项目、企业级应用。的确,Java 非常强大、稳定,适合构建大规模、高负载的区块链钱包。不过,Java 学习曲线相对较陡,需要一定的基础。它适合有经验的开发者,尤其是在那些需要高安全性和高可扩展性的项目中,Java 是个不错的选择。

        如果你打算开发一个需要面临大量用户的区块链钱包,Java 无疑是为你提供了强大的支持。因为大部分企业都在用 Java,找工作的前景也相对乐观。

        所需工具和框架

        除了选择开发语言,工具和框架也很重要。这些工具可以让你的开发过程更加流畅。比如说,Truffle 和 Ganache 是以太坊开发很常用的工具,能帮助你快速搭建以太坊环境。

        还有例如 Remix 这样的在线IDE,可以帮助你在线编写和部署智能合约,非常适合初学者练手。如果你打算做一个移动端的钱包,像 React Native 这样的框架也值得一试,能够一次性支持安卓和iOS。

        安全性如何保障?

        开发钱包时,安全性是个大问题。毕竟,里面存的是用户的钱啊,所以绝不能马虎。首先,你应该了解加密技术,包括对称加密、非对称加密以及哈希算法。这些都是保护用户资产的基本功。

        另外,你还需要定期进行安全测试,比如渗透测试、代码审查等,确保钱包能够抵御各种攻击。这方面的资料很多,网络上都有相关的开源项目和文档供你参考。

        寻找社区和资源

        有一个强大的社区对开发者尤其重要,尤其是在你遇到问题或者需要学习新技术的时候。可以加入一些区块链开发相关的论坛,比如 GitHub、Stack Overflow 等。这里的开发者来自世界各地,大家互相帮助,气氛也很友好。

        此外,定期参加相关的技术会议,和其他开发者分享经验,也是不错的选择。在这种活动中,你能学到很多新鲜的技术和思路,同时还能扩展你的人脉。

        总结自己的学习路线

        最后别忘了建立一个自己的学习路线。从基础的编程语言开始,再逐步深入区块链相关的知识和技能。可以尝试着自己做一些小项目,比如制作一个简单的钱包应用,来验证所学的知识。

        有时候,学习过程中难免会遭遇挫折。但别急,这都是成长让你必须经历的。保持好奇心,勇于尝试,相信你一定可以在区块链钱包开发领域开辟出一片新天地!

        大家喜欢的这个钱包开发小指南,希望能对你有所帮助!如果你有其他的想法或问题,欢迎随时和我交流哦!

        注册我们的时事通讯

        我们的进步

        本周热门

        如何将USDT安全存放到冷钱
        如何将USDT安全存放到冷钱
        IM钱包支持USDT,如何安全
        IM钱包支持USDT,如何安全
        如何安全使用火币比特币
        如何安全使用火币比特币
        以太坊的官方钱包被称为
        以太坊的官方钱包被称为
        如何轻松注册以太坊钱包
        如何轻松注册以太坊钱包

          地址

          Address : 1234 lock, Charlotte, North Carolina, United States

          Phone : +12 534894364

          Email : info@example.com

          Fax : +12 534894364

          快速链接

          • 关于我们
          • 产品
          • 钱包教程
          • 支持
          • tpwallet官网下载
          • tpwallet官方app下载

          通讯

          通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

          tpwallet官网下载

          tpwallet官网下载是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
          我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tpwallet官网下载都是您信赖的选择。

          • facebook
          • twitter
          • google
          • linkedin

          2003-2026 tpwallet官网下载 @版权所有 |网站地图|桂ICP备2022008651号-1

            Login Now
            We'll never share your email with anyone else.

            Don't have an account?

                
                        
                Register Now

                By clicking Register, I agree to your terms